They are racking up outsized healthcare and    retirement    obligations that are bankrupting the federal and state    governments. Upwards of 10,000 baby boomers are reaching    traditional retirement age each day, signing up for Medicare    and Social Security, and for those with low incomes, using    Medicaid services. Beyond lots of plans and even more talk,    there is no overall government strategy in place to deal with    these expenses.  <\/p>\n<p>    [See     Choosing Your Mutual Fund Lineup.]  <\/p>\n<p>    But these very same people are also the dominant    consumer-spending force in the U.S. economy and will continue    to be for decades. In 2010, more than 32 percent of the nearly    309 million people in the United States were 50 or older.    That's nearly 100 million people, with roughly 60 percent of    them between the ages of 50 and 64, and 40 percent age 65 and    older. Beyond lots of plans and even more talk, there is no    overall business strategy in place to capitalize on this    market.  <\/p>\n<p>    \"There's such a different orientation in dealing with these    issues, depending on where you are,\" says Jody Holtzman, senior    vice president for thought leadership at AARP. \"In Washington,    all you hear from the pundits is that they all sound like a    bunch of Chicken Littles. The sky is falling. There's a fiscal    train wreck coming. What they're really saying is that we can't    afford all these old people.\"  <\/p>\n<p>    But in the private sector, Holtzman adds, businesses and    nonprofit organizations look at a market of 100 million people    and see things differently. \"There, you don't see this as a    problem. You see it as an opportunity,\" he says.  <\/p>\n<p>    Despite this different mindset, Holtzman says, businesses have    tended to see older consumers as parts of different commercial    silos and not as part of a powerful and unified new market. So,    there are senior housing projects, lots of healthcare products,    some efforts at age-friendly home remodeling, travel and    leisure services, and a boatload of retirement investment    services. But companies have been dealing with this in a    compartmentalized way.  <\/p>\n<p>    [See     The Fiduciary Debate: Should You Care?]  <\/p>\n<p>    For Holtzman, and naturally for AARP, it makes good sense to    break down silo walls and help build a unified market for    providing products and services to seniors. He and other    colleagues have coined the phrase \"longevity economy\" to    describe the age wave in business terms and generate some buzz.  <\/p>\n<p>    Recognition is the first challenge, Holtzman says.
